The differences between oil field equipment mechanics and electro mechanics can be seen in a few details. Each job has different responsibilities and duties. It typically takes 1-2 years to become both an oil field equipment mechanic and an electro mechanic. Additionally, an electro mechanic has an average salary of $59,526, which is higher than the $39,633 average annual salary of an oil field equipment mechanic.

Oil field equipment mechanics and electro mechanics have different pay scales, as shown below.
| Oil Field Equipment Mechanic | Electro Mechanic | |
| Average salary | $39,633 | $59,526 |
| Salary range | Between $29,000 And $52,000 | Between $44,000 And $79,000 |
